To me the most exciting thing about it is the huge leap in dynamic range provided by the cutting edge TDI sensor and LED light source. All other scanners are able to capture a dynamic range of around 2.3 film density (when there is 3.1- 3.3 density on motion picture negative). The Scanity blew us away with it's ability to capture 3.3 density which means that for the first time ever DPs can be confident that their DI scans are getting all the information on their negative.

 

Our Scanity is capable of scanning 16mm, S16mm, Ultra 16mm and 35mm (all perfs + Vista Vision) at 2K or 4K.

 

For those DIY types one cool workflow we're offering is 2K and 4K ProRes 4444 delivery (rather than DPX), which lightens the file size by about 1/6th from DPX. Of course we do SMPTE Standard LOG or Colored DPX as well.

Thanks Will. The Spirit looks great... but it can't touch the Scanity in terms of resolution, dynamic range or image stability. As such the Scanity will service 4 types of clients:

1) Feature Films that want the best possile quality and need a 4K DI for to be able to have content for the coming 4K D-Cinema screens that we'll be seeing more of now that the new 4K DLP chip (Christie, Barco & NEC) projectors is hitting the market:

We will be installing one of these projectors in our 4K DI theater and offering 4K DCPs so offering a full 4K pipeline has already garnered some interest. I also think people will be blown away when they actually see 35mm at 4K resolution. All these years we've only been seeing a portion of the resolution of what is there on the negative.

 

2) Restoration Projects that want to restore film at it's true resolution. We have a few high end 4K restorations under way that we can't discuss yet but the owners of the film elements have been hugely pleased with the results:

3)TV commercials that have VFX shots and require fast turn around for high-quality, pin-registered scans.

 

4) Anyone who wants or requires higher dynamic range scans (ie.. especially those that have print stock they need scanned).

I don't doubt that the Scanity captures the greatest DRange of all competitive scanners, but I find it hard to believe that it can match the true resolution of the Filmlight Northlight scanner with the 8K linear CCD arrays.

 

Film Fact# 1 - Kodak 35mm Vision 3 has around 85-100 lp/mm of resolution (depending on ASA) which is slightly less than 4K

 

Film Fact# 2 - Vision 3 has around 3.1 film density of dynamic range which far exceeds the capabilities of most scanners

 

It's true 8K from any scanner would resolve more lp/mm (around 220) than a 4K scan (around 110). But since there's less than 100 line pairs on 35mm negative I'd take 4K and 3.5 film density over 8K at 2.4 film density any day... it's the dynamic range that's being thrown away not the resolution.

 

Did you do any comparisons with the Imagica Imager XE Advanced Plus? It has a 10K CCD option for 8Kx6K/4Kx3K 35/4P scans. I'm sure it's very slow, but I'd love to see the output on that machine. (http://www.bcs.tv/pdf/model/805761/XE_ADV+.pdf)

 

No I did not test the Imagica as it's not really thought of as a "gold standard" DI scanner. The goal of the tests were to compare the gold standard ARRI and Northlight pin-registered scanners to the new crop of optically/electronically pin-registered scanners (GoldenEye, P+S Technic Steady Frame, Scanity). As to the second part of the question about 10K 35mm scans I promise what you need when scanning 35mm... to quote John Galt's "truth about 4K" article is "better K, not more K". And if you can get better K (full dynamic range) and go fast that's a pretty compelling argument for a film scanning technology.

 

Does the Scanity have a wetgate option?

No... but it does embed IR dirt mattes and with the new digital ice solutions it's very powerful restoration scanner as well.

 

Lastly, what top of the line scanners are being used today for 65/5P? Given how many lines it could resolve, wouldn't you need an ultra high resolution scanner to prevent any aliasing? Who does the film scanning for IMAX feature films?

/quote]

 

I could be wrong but there are only (2) 70mm scanners that I am aware of in the world right now. The Imagica Bigfoot at Fotokem (11K) and the 70mm modified Northlight 8K at IMAX.

 

If you take away anything that I am saying it's that when it comes to scanning film resolution is easy... dynamic range is hard. Go for the dynamic range! Or both if you have the time and money to pay for it.

The Film Fact #1 is only comparing spatial resolution still-for-still but the resolution of film and its ability to convey detail isn't realized without the temporal component, because grain isn't fixed unlike the rigid row and column of a digital display or scanner which creates exactly the type of edges our visual system is tuned to key off most ricky-tick. Digital needs even more spatial oversampling to compensate, or it needs to otherwise overcome the limitations of fixed grid sampling.

 

This is the principle behind the unfortunate Aaton Penelope. The 4K scanning employed for 16mm reversal film, in the case of the remastering of The Texas Chainsaw Massacre might seem like bonkers overkill but that's closer to where 35mm scanning needs to head if you're interested in more than just "good enough".
